Try going to a local university's dental school.. they perform work there at half the rate of what private dentists will charge.

The work will more than likely be done by a grad student, but under the supervision of a licensed dentist/professor. It's just as good as going to a regular practice, but a lot cheaper.

But get that tooth taken care of ASAP. I waited too long to get a cavity filled on my back molar and got an infection.. but it's all good and taken care of now. :)

Call your dentist a few minutes before they open and tell them you have an emergency and HAVE to be seen today. They will accomodate you.

If you have any codeine or the like, take a couple but try to AVOID aspirin as that's going to thin your blood and and increase your clotting time.

Don't do it yourself, if you crack the tooth while trying to extract it, it will complicate things.

If you go to the ER, NEVER request a pain med by name/dose etc. They will think you're a drug seeker and at best give you a shot of Torodol which is only a high strength NSAID.
